Things to do in Moab?
Living in Moab, UT is an incredible experience. The small town of just under 6,000 people is located in a stunning landscape surrounded by red rock canyons and rolling hills. Moab is known for its outdoor recreation opportunities including mountain biking, hiking, and river sports that attract tourists from around the world. Despite its small size, Moab has a thriving local culture with plenty of shops, restaurants, art galleries, and live music venues for residents to enjoy. Summers are warm and sunny but winters can have snowfall so there is something for everyone all year round. Things to do in Carbondale?
Living in Carbondale, CO is an incredible experience. The natural beauty of the area provides ample opportunities for outdoor recreation including hiking, mountain biking, skiing, and kayaking. The town itself is small but vibrant with a strong sense of community and plenty of local businesses and restaurants to explore. There are also plenty of events throughout the year that help bring everyone together, such as the 4th of July Parade or the Carbondale Mountain Fair.
